P0304 on 2017-2022 Volkswagen Jetta: Cylinder 4 Misfire Causes and Fixes

P0304 on a 2017-2022 Jetta most often means a bad ignition coil or a worn-out spark plug for cylinder 4. A simple 'swap test' can identify the faulty part in under an hour. Expect to pay around $40-$80 for a new ignition coil or $15-$25 for a new spark plug. In some 2016-2017 models, an ECM software update may be required per a TSB.

⚠️ Drivable, but... — If the check engine light is solid, you can drive cautiously to a repair shop. If it's flashing, pull over as soon as it is safe and have the vehicle towed to prevent expensive catalytic converter damage from unburnt fuel.

The trouble code P0304 indicates that your Jetta's Engine Control Module (ECM) has detected a misfire in cylinder number 4. An engine misfire occurs when the fuel and air mixture in the cylinder fails to ignite properly. The ECM monitors the rotational speed of the crankshaft via the crankshaft position sensor, and when it detects a slight slowdown as cylinder 4 is supposed to fire, it triggers the P0304 code and the Check Engine Light.

What's Unique About the 2017-2022 Volkswagen JETTA

The engine bay of a modern Volkswagen Jetta featuring the 1.4L TSI EA211 engine.
The 2017-2022 Jetta utilizes the EA211 engine family, which features a compact turbocharger and direct injection system sensitive to ignition health.

The 2017-2022 Jetta, spanning the end of the Mk6 and the majority of the Mk7 generation, primarily uses the 1.4L TSI (engine code CZTA) or the later 1.5L TSI from the EA211 engine family. While generally reliable, these direct-injection engines are sensitive to ignition component health and fuel quality. Volkswagen has also issued Technical Service Bulletin V011620 (also numbered 2045602) for 2016-2017 models, indicating that the ECM's misfire detection could be overly sensitive, sometimes requiring a software update to resolve false P030x codes.

The primary engine in non-GLI models is the 1.4L TSI (EA211 family, code CZTA) and later the 1.5L TSI (EA211 Evo). The common causes and diagnostic process are nearly identical for both generations due to the shared engine architecture.

Symptoms You May Notice

  • Check Engine Light is on or flashing
  • Rough or shaky engine idle
  • Hesitation or loss of power during acceleration
  • Reduced fuel economy
  • Engine stalling at stops
  • Unusual engine noises like knocking or pinging
  • Smell of unburnt gasoline from the exhaust
  • EPC (Electronic Power Control) light may flash on the dashboard.
⚠️ Don't Waste Money on the Wrong Fix
  • Replacing the oxygen sensor, as a misfire can cause lean or rich readings, but the sensor is usually just reporting the problem, not causing it.
  • Replacing the catalytic converter, which can be damaged by a persistent misfire but is not the root cause.
  • Assuming a flashing EPC light is a separate throttle body issue, when it can be triggered by a severe misfire event.

Most Likely Causes

Side-by-side comparison of a healthy new ignition coil versus a failed coil with visible carbon tracking and heat damage.
A healthy ignition coil (left) vs. a failed unit (right) showing carbon tracking. On the Jetta, these coils are the most frequent cause of a P0304 code.
  1. Failed Ignition Coil 🔴 High Probability Coil-on-plug ignition systems are a common failure point on many modern engines, including VW's TSI engines, as they are subject to high heat and vibration. They are considered a frequent maintenance item by many owners.
    How to confirm: Swap the ignition coil from cylinder 4 with another cylinder (e.g., cylinder 3). Cylinder 4 is the cylinder closest to the transmission (driver's side in the US). Clear the codes and drive. If the code changes to P0303, the ignition coil is faulty. 🎬 See how to diagnose a P0304 misfire code on your Jetta.
    Typical fix: Replace the failed ignition coil. It is often recommended to replace all four coils at the same time for preventative maintenance, but replacing just the failed one will solve the immediate problem.
    Est. part cost: $40 - $80
  2. Worn or Fouled Spark Plug 🔴 High Probability Spark plugs are a regular maintenance item with a typical lifespan of around 40,000 miles on these engines. Turbocharged engines like the 1.4T can be harder on plugs, and extended service intervals can lead to wear that causes a misfire.
    How to confirm: After ruling out the coil, swap the spark plug from cylinder 4 with another cylinder (e.g., cylinder 2). If the code moves to P0302, the spark plug is the issue. Visually inspect the plug for wear, carbon fouling, oil deposits, or an incorrect gap.
    Typical fix: Replace the spark plug in cylinder 4. It is best practice to replace all spark plugs as a set to ensure even performance and avoid future misfires. Ensure they are gapped correctly, typically between 0.024 to 0.071 inches, though it's best to verify the exact spec for your 🎬 Watch: Step-by-step spark plug replacement for the Mk7 Jetta. model year.
    Est. part cost: $15 - $25 per plug
  3. Clogged or Faulty Fuel Injector 🟡 Medium Probability Direct injection (DI) fuel injectors operate under high pressure and can be susceptible to clogging from fuel deposits or carbon buildup over time, sometimes exacerbated by poor fuel quality.
    How to confirm: This is more difficult for a DIYer. A mechanic can perform a fuel injector balance test. You can also swap the injector from cylinder 4 to another cylinder, but this is a more involved job. Listening for the injector's 'clicking' sound with a mechanic's stethoscope can confirm if it's activating.
    Typical fix: Replace the fuel injector for cylinder 4. Some owners attempt a professional fuel system cleaning first, but replacement is often necessary for a permanent fix.
    Est. part cost: $70 - $150

Rare But Worth Checking

  • ECM Software Too Sensitive: VW released TSB V011620 (also listed as 2045602) for 2016-2017 Jettas with the 1.4T (CZTA) engine, stating the original ECM software was too sensitive for misfire detection. If ignition and fuel components are confirmed good, a dealer software update is the specified fix. This TSB also addresses other fault codes.
  • Intake Valve Carbon Buildup: A known issue on many direct-injection engines, including the EA211 family. Carbon can build up on the back of the intake valves, restricting airflow and causing misfires, especially at idle or during cold starts. This typically requires professional cleaning (e.g., walnut blasting) and may become noticeable after 50,000-70,000 miles. Some owners have had their intake inspected with a borescope to confirm buildup before committing to the service.
  • Loss of Compression: This is a serious mechanical engine issue, such as a bad valve, worn piston rings, or a damaged head gasket. A compression test is required to diagnose this. A healthy cylinder should have compression within 10-15% of the others. If cylinder 4 is significantly lower, further internal engine diagnosis is needed.
  • Damaged Intake Manifold Runner Flaps: In some cases, the plastic flaps inside the intake manifold can break or become stuck, disrupting airflow to a specific cylinder and causing misfires. This may be accompanied by a P2004 code ('Intake Manifold Runner Control Stuck Open').

Diagnosis Steps

A technician identifying the ignition coils on a Volkswagen Jetta engine.
To diagnose a P0304, swap the ignition coil from Cylinder 4 (closest to the transmission) to another cylinder to see if the code follows the part.
  1. Read the code with an OBD-II scanner and check for any other stored codes. Freeze frame data can show the engine conditions (RPM, load, temp) when the misfire occurred.
  2. Note if the Check Engine Light is solid or flashing. A flashing light means stop driving to prevent catalytic converter damage.
  3. Perform an ignition coil 'swap test': Move the coil from cylinder 4 to cylinder 3. Clear the codes and see if the misfire code changes to P0303. If it does, the coil is bad.
  4. If the coil is good, perform a spark plug 'swap test': Move the plug from cylinder 4 to cylinder 2. Clear the codes and see if the misfire code changes to P0302. If it does, the plug is bad.
  5. Inspect the wiring and connector for the ignition coil and fuel injector on cylinder 4 for any damage, corrosion, or loose connections. Damaged connector clips are common.
  6. If the misfire remains on cylinder 4, the issue may be the fuel injector. This is more complex to test and may require a professional.
  7. For 2016-2017 models, check with a VW dealer if TSB V011620 has been performed on your vehicle. If not, and other causes are ruled out, an ECM update may be the solution.
  8. If all else fails, perform an engine compression test to check for mechanical problems within cylinder 4.
  9. Consider a borescope inspection of the intake valves for carbon buildup, especially on vehicles with over 60,000 miles.

Related Codes That Often Appear With This One

  • P0300 — If multiple cylinders are misfiring intermittently, you will see a P0300 (Random/Multiple Cylinder Misfire) code alongside the specific cylinder code.
  • P0301, P0302, P0303 — These codes indicate misfires in cylinders 1, 2, and 3, respectively. Seeing them with P0304 points to a problem affecting the entire engine, like a major vacuum leak, low fuel pressure, or an issue with an ECM software update.
  • P0354 — This code indicates a malfunction in the ignition coil primary or secondary circuit for cylinder 4. If you see this with P0304, it strongly points to a bad ignition coil or a problem with its wiring/connector.

Platform-Specific Known Issues

  • A Technical Service Bulletin (TSB #V011620 / 2045602) was issued for 2016-2017 Jettas with the 1.4T (CZTA) engine for overly sensitive misfire detection, which could trigger P0300-P0304 codes. The fix is an ECM software update performed by a dealer.
  • The manufacturer TSB #VIN4APIN20211116 notes that P030x codes can appear in combination with various other engine faults, suggesting a comprehensive diagnostic scan is important.
  • TSB #VIN-4-A-PIN-2018 also mentions P0300-P0304 codes appearing after a specific software update (level 0003), indicating that software can be both a cause and a solution.

Mechanic-Grade Diagnostic Values

  • High-Pressure Fuel System Pressure — expected: 140 to 200 bar (2030 to 2900 PSI), depending on load and engine speed.. Failure: Pressure that is significantly below this range under load can indicate a failing High-Pressure Fuel Pump (HPFP) and cause misfires.
  • Low-Pressure Fuel System Pressure — expected: 3.5 to 6 bar (50 to 87 PSI) at the high-pressure pump inlet.. Failure: A drop in this pressure indicates a weak in-tank fuel pump or a clogged filter, starving the high-pressure system.
  • Engine Compression (1.4T/1.5T EA211) — expected: New engine: 160 to 203 PSI.. Failure: Wear limit is 101 PSI. The maximum allowable difference between any two cylinders is 43.5 PSI. Low compression on cylinder 4 is a mechanical fault.

Scan Tool Commands That Help

  • VCDS (VAG-COM) by Ross-Tech: Advanced Measuring Values — To monitor live misfire counts for each cylinder. Search for 'misfire' and select the counters for cylinders 1-4. This allows you to see if the misfire is constant or intermittent and confirm if it stays on cylinder 4 after swapping components.
  • VCDS (VAG-COM) by Ross-Tech: Measuring Blocks (older, non-UDS controllers) — On some earlier models in the vehicle range, misfire counters are found in Measuring Block Groups 015 and 016. Group 016 will show the counter for Cylinder 4.

Wiring & Ground Locations

  • Engine/Transmission Ground Connection — A primary ground strap is typically located between the transmission housing and the vehicle's chassis, often underneath the battery tray area.. A corroded or loose main engine ground can cause a variety of electrical issues, including weak spark and erratic sensor readings that can lead to misfire codes.
  • Main Engine Bay Ground Point — On the firewall/bulkhead, just above and behind the battery. It is a common attachment point for multiple brown ground wires.. This is a central grounding hub. Corrosion here can affect the entire engine management system, including the ignition coils' ground path, potentially causing misfires.
  • Ignition Coil Connector (Cylinder 4) — The 4-pin electrical connector on top of the ignition coil for the cylinder closest to the transmission.. The plastic locking tab on these connectors can become brittle and break, leading to a poor connection that can cause a P0354 (Ignition Coil Circuit Malfunction) and a P0304. Ensure it is fully seated and the internal pins are not damaged.

Real Owner Repair Stories

  • Reddit user in /r/jetta (2015 Jetta S (Mk6) with 277k miles) — Misfire under load between 2200-2800 RPM, not constant. Idles smoothly.
    ❌ Tried (didn't work) Replaced spark plugs (twice), Replaced ignition coil (twice) with aftermarket parts, Replaced ignition coil wiring connector, Performed a compression test which came back good.
    ✅ What actually fixed it The owner reported the final fix was using genuine VW OEM parts instead of aftermarket auto parts store brands for the ignition components. The car was sensitive to the part quality.
  • Reddit user in /r/jetta (2019 Jetta R-Line 1.4T at 70,000 km (approx. 43,500 miles)) — P0304 misfire code, check engine light, and a rotten egg smell from the battery area.
    ❌ Tried (didn't work) User took it to a mechanic for diagnosis rather than trying parts.
    ✅ What actually fixed it The consensus from other owners was that this was a combination of two separate, but common, maintenance issues: the misfire was likely a spark plug or coil (plugs are recommended around 60k miles), and the battery smell indicated a failing battery, which is typical after about 4 years.

Model Year Variations Within This Range

  • 2017-2021: These model years primarily use the 1.4L TSI (EA211, engine code CZTA) engine.
  • 2022: For the 2022 model year, the Jetta was updated with the 1.5L TSI (EA211 Evo) engine. While architecturally similar, some parts, including sensors and internal components, may differ from the 1.4T.
